Cyclists have bared it all for the annual World Naked Bike Ride yesterday.
Wearing helmets and little else, 250 cyclists took to the streets of Melbourne in a cheeky public display.
Riders raised awareness for bike safety with the mantra: “do you see us now?”
Organiser Laurence Barnes said the event was launched to remind drivers cyclists shared the road too, and to raise awareness of body-shaming issues and climate change.
“We’re showing blood and flesh to show drivers that we have nothing to protect us when we’re on the road,” he said.
